Zippers are primal and modern at the very same time…
Zippers are primal and modern at the very same time. On the one hand, your zipper is primitive and reptilian, on the other, mechanical and slick. A zipper is where the Industrial Revolution meets the Cobra Cult.
Sourced, Jitterbug Perfume
(1984)
